The Hollywood Reporter have word today that Death Ray Films and company are looking at bringing I, FRANKENSTEIN to the big screen! I, FRANKENSTEIN of course is an upcoming comic that deals with classic monster characters, including Frankenstein’s Monster, the Invisible Man, Dracula and the Hunchback of Notre Dame, in a contemporary film noir setting. As stated Frankenstein signs up as a private investigator while Dracula tackles the world of organized crime and Invisible Man goes all secret agent.

You may recognize a few of the other names helping out with this project. TMNT’s Kevin Grevioux is penning the script and serving as producer. Fitting considering he penned the upcoming comic. Patrick Tatopoulos is set to direct. Death Ray also have WAR MONKEYS and an adaptation of EL ZOMBO on the way, though I think it’s safe to say I’m most looking forward to I, FRANKENSTEIN.
